Understanding ETL (Extract, Transform, Load)
ETL is a process that involves extracting data from multiple sources, transforming it into a consistent format, and loading it into a centralized repository, often referred to as a data warehouse. This process is essential for facilitating data consistency, accuracy, and availability for analysis and reporting purposes in the BI ecosystem. In the realm of data management and analytics, ETL plays a pivotal role in supporting the exploration and implementation of what is business intelligence.
Improve Business Intelligence with ETL & Data Warehousing
ETL acts as a bridge between various data sources and the data warehouse. It enables organizations to gather data from disparate systems such as databases, APIs, spreadsheets, and more and consolidate it into a unified format. This consolidation allows businesses to analyze large volumes of data efficiently, identify patterns, and derive meaningful insights for decision-making.
Stage 1:
The data extraction phase involves pulling data from source systems using different techniques, such as querying databases, web scraping, or integrating with third-party APIs.

Stage 2:
The data transformation phase focuses on cleaning, filtering, and standardizing the data to ensure consistency and eliminate redundancies.

Stage 3:
Finally, the data loading phase efficiently transfers the transformed data into the warehouse, ensuring its integrity and accessibility for BI processes.

How Data Warehousing Streamlines Business Intelligence Services
The role of data warehousing in BI services:
Data warehousing plays a crucial role in business intelligence services by providing a scalable and efficient infrastructure for storing and managing large volumes of data. It enables businesses to integrate and consolidate data from disparate sources, ensuring consistency and accuracy.
Data warehousing also facilitates the creation of Business Intelligence reports, flexible and intuitive dashboards, and visualizations that empower users to explore data and derive meaningful insights.
